Understanding EB5 Eligibility Demands
What makes a private eligible for the EB5 visa program? To certify, a candidate has to spend a minimum of $1 million in a brand-new company, or $500,000 in a targeted work location, which is specified as a backwoods or one with high joblessness. The investment should develop at least ten full-time jobs for united state employees within 2 years. Furthermore, the financier needs to show that the funds made use of for the financial investment were acquired through lawful methods.
Candidates are additionally called for to give an extensive service plan detailing the project's usefulness and work production capacity. The investor must be proactively associated with business, although they are not required to take care of everyday operations. Meeting these standards warranties that the individual can add to the united state economic situation while going after permanent residency via the EB5 program.
The Investment Process Explained
After making sure eligibility needs are satisfied, the investment procedure for the EB5 visa program begins with picking an appropriate task to invest in. Potential financiers generally take into consideration jobs affiliated with Regional Centers, as these entities commonly improve the procedure and supply pre-approved financial investment opportunities. When a project is determined, the investor needs to finish the required due persistance, assessing aspects such as monetary estimates, administration experience, and the task's overall feasibility.
Adhering to the selection, the financier must transfer the necessary resources, which is generally $1 million or $500,000 for targeted work areas. This investment needs to go to risk, demonstrating a commitment to the job's success. After financing is secured, the investor submits Type I-526, Immigrant Application by Alien Investor, to the U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Solutions (USCIS) Upon authorization, the capitalist can after that continue to look for a conditional copyright Card, paving the way for long-term residency.
Task Production Standard and Its Importance
While the EB5 visa program emphasizes investment as a pathway to U.S. residency, the task development requirements play a crucial role in determining the success of an application. To certify, an EB5 investor should maintain or create at least ten full time tasks for U.S. workers within two years of their investment. This requirement underscores the program's purpose of stimulating the U.S. economic situation via international financial investments. The tasks should be direct, referring to the capitalist's organization, or indirect, created through regional facilities that merge investments for larger projects.
Capitalists should provide durable documents and evidence to show conformity with these requirements. Failing to meet the task production requirement can cause the rejection of the copyright card application, highlighting its significance in the EB5 process.
